Re: Ant control
Mix Icing sugar and ant powder 1:1 and spoon it under kitchen units and behind appliances or directly on the nest if you find it.

Re: Ant control
I have a spray its in a grey bottle specifically for ants kills them instantly Sertex fluid karinca. Most supermarkets have it.

Re: Ant control
We use that too Deniz1.....the ants really don't like it. We have also put a couple of those little ant traps you can get in the supermarkets, on the worksurfaces. They are meant to last 3 months I think. A combination of the two seems to have done the trick....and of course making sure that no food or crumbs are left out.....
